Like with the number input type, you should supply a pattern for browsers that dont support this input type. Dec 15, 2004 this prevents malicious input in email address fields that cause buffer overruns. Jul 06, 2019 type description available input types. If set to equal validator will look for dataequal attribute. Then validator will match value with values from attributes. Validation done in the browser is called clientside validation, while validation done on the server is called serverside validation. When you create a url input with the proper type value, url, you get automatic validation that the entered text is at least in the correct form to potentially be a legitimate url. Html injection is just the injection of markup language code to the document of the page. Ecommerce freebies graphics html illustrator inspiration ios. Always add the tag for best accessibility practices.
If set to length validator will look for dataminlength, datamaxlength or datalength attributes. While we should still use serverside validation, im going to discuss how we can make the most of clientside validation to reduce the number server requests. The value of a readonly input field will be sent when submitting the form. The ship url actually creates a work ticket to pull the parts and ship them. Email validation regex patterns are a hotly debated issue.
Sep 23, 20 url input typehtml5 in this video, we illustrate how you can implement simple url validation using url input type. The article also explains how a validation polyfill can be made. It returns a string value which represents the regular expression that a url field value is checked against. In this video well look at the text, email, and url input types. Return to the main validator page and click the validate by direct input tab at the top of the page. Html5 form field validation also works with numeric input types and with the required specification. Instructor the most basic type of input field is text. This property is used to reflect the html required attribute. It is very difficult to validate rich content submitted by a user. Depending on browser support, the url field can be automatically validated when submitted. Html5 provides a new property for calling the validations on the click of a specific button.
I tested a ton of them specifically looking for ones that met rfc822 specs. This validator checks the markup validity of web documents in html, xhtml, smil, mathml, etc. Has four optional variables allowallschemes, allow2slashes, nofragments and schemes which can be used to configure this validator. Stealing other persons identity may also happen during html injection. Url validation is a common task in web development, and thankfully. Dec 16, 2019 net we mainly use a validationgroup for doing validation on the click of a specific button, but this property is not available for html controls.
Specifies that its input element is a control for editing an absolute url given in the elements value. As an alternative you can also try our nondtdbased validator. Finally, notice that instead of using text as the input type for the email and url fields, we use email and url. The email input type will alert users if the supplied email address is invalid. The html tag is used within a form to declare an input element. Html form validation two ways of html form validation with. Here is the complete syntax for url validations url validates url format. Just that alone is a ux consideration all too many forms fail on. The input readonly attribute specifies that an input field is readonly. After submitted by data, the data has sent to a server and perform validation checks. In this jquery form validation, we will create the basic form and the validation will be done for the form.
E commerce freebies graphics html illustrator inspiration ios. Net we mainly use a validationgroup for doing validation on the click of a specific button, but this property is not available for html controls. This prevents malicious input in email address fields that cause buffer overruns. How to check that a users input matches validation criteria that you define. In this video, we illustrate how you can implement simple url validation using url input type.
Installation you can follow one of these methods to get the package. So lets have a look at our implementation, starting with the html its based. The validation interceptor does the validation itself and creates a list of fieldspecific errors. Html dom input checkbox required property geeksforgeeks. Then select and copy all the code on the page from dtd to closing. Net has some builtin validation of requests that can be extended to make it more effective, but this approach has changed with asp. Before we submit the data to the database it is important to validate the form. Learn proper use of form fields, including the new html5 input types, and discover how to add interactivity such as form validation, style forms with css, create responsive layouts, add interactivity such as form validation, and design forms for usability and accessibility.
In the previous article we looked at the input element, covering the original values of the type attribute available since the early days of html. Jan 22, 2011 html5 form field validation also works with numeric input types and with the required specification. Validation is performed on the client machine web browsers. This tag supports all the global attributes described in.
Suppose we enhanced the above html to add an input field with required and another input field of type number with min and max specifications. In this, we will use the html file with validation to validate the clientside validation before we are submitting it to the server. Magically convert a simple text input into a cool tag list with this jquery plugin. Validating urls require complex regular expressions. Html5 brought us several types such as number, date and email. Browse other questions tagged html validation input or ask your own question. Java is in a unique position when it comes to xml tool infrastructure. Input validation should happen as early as possible in the data flow, preferably as soon as the data is. The creation of web forms has always been a complex task. When you enter data, the browser andor the web server will check to see that the data is in the correct format and within the constraints set by the application. This is the most basic and is supported in all browsers,even very old ones.
This can help avoid cases in which the user mistypes their web sites address, or provides an invalid one. Html5 brought us several input types such as number, date and email. This module hasnt support all the attrs defined in html5 spec yet, just has done below so far. As a web site designer its well worth it to you to obtain the latest version of browsers. The typeurl input doesnt accept schemeless urls because of that.688 354 1392 216 1527 609 1268 544 1383 595 894 285 480 165 332 421 715 1155 602 810 348 415 1528 928 814 1310 1550 1079 583 823 1255 1263 631 936 1219 1009 1432 842 374 439 1016 818 1014 1221 88 842 1269 558 1077